HCV enters the body and reproduces in the host's (infected person's) body, specifically targeting the liver. HCV often evades the body's immune system and causes disease as a result of direct attack on the liver. 2 The body's own immune system response also produces harmful inflammation of the liver.

Hepatitis C is a liver infection caused by the hepatitis C virus (HCV) that can lead to chronic infection causing cirrhosis, liver cancer, … Web18 mrt. 2024 · Hepatitis C is most commonly spread through blood-to-blood contact. It is very infectious and the virus can stay alive outside the body for up to several weeks. The infection can be spread by: sharing needles and syringes, particularly when injecting drugs medical and dental equipment that has not been properly sterilised
